Abstract
There exist several publications addressing and presenting an optimal design strategy for resonant LLC converters to end up with minimal ohmic losses. However, none of these papers takes unavoidable component tolerances into account. As a result, the specification cannot be met anymore for critical operation points. This paper proposes a new design strategy for resonant LLC converters, which incorporates these component tolerances. The resulting design provides minimal rms losses and guarantees the fulfillment of the converter specification under all circumstances at the same time.
